The Mechanics of 3 Easy Methods To Oven-Roasted Perfection: Cooking Pork Chops At 250 Degrees

At its core, 3 Easy Methods To Oven-Roasted Perfection: Cooking Pork Chops At 250 Degrees involves using a low-temperature oven (250°F) to cook pork chops to optimal tenderness and juiciness. The key lies in understanding the Maillard reaction, a chemical reaction between amino acids and reducing sugars that occurs when food is cooked, resulting in the formation of new flavor compounds and browning.

The low temperature of 250°F allows for slow and even cooking, preventing the formation of tough, overcooked exterior while retaining the juicy, tender interior. By cooking pork chops at this temperature, chefs and home cooks can achieve a perfect balance of texture and flavor.

Q: What type of pork chops should I use for 3 Easy Methods To Oven-Roasted Perfection: Cooking Pork Chops At 250 Degrees?

A: Opt for boneless pork chops (1-1.5 inches thick) with a fat content of 15-20%. This will ensure even cooking and a tender, juicy final product.

Q: Can I cook pork chops at 250°F for a shorter or longer period?

A: Yes, but be aware that cooking times may vary depending on the thickness of the pork chops and personal preference for doneness. Use a meat thermometer to ensure the internal temperature reaches 145°F.
